Type description
Van Geel et al. 1981: Cylindrical fungal spores, 11 X 9-10 μm, with in the equatorial plane a characteristic septum with strong pigmentation, and provided with a central pore ca. 0.5 μm wide. Both ends of the spore hyaline.
